For waters beyond five nautical miles of shore on Lake Erie

Waves are the significant wave height - the average of the highest
1/3 of the wave spectrum. Occasional wave height is the average of
the highest 1/10 of the wave spectrum.

.SYNOPSIS...
Low pressure 29.90 inches will weaken as it moves east into the
Ohio Valley this evening into tonight. High pressure 30.10 inches
will build southeast over the region tonight through Wednesday
night before a cold front tracks east across the Great Lakes late
Thursday into Friday. High pressure 29.90 inches will return to
the Great Lakes over the weekend.
